An orthodontist is a dentist trained to identify, stop, and treat teeth and jaw abnormalities. They correct existing conditions and are trained to determine issues that might establish in the future. Orthodontists deal with individuals of all ages, from youngsters to grownups. Individuals usually link an ideal smile with health.


All orthodontists are dentists, but not all dental practitioners are orthodontists. Orthodontic residency programs offer intensive, concentrated instruction for dental specialists. What is the distinction between a dentist and an orthodontist? All dental practitioners, consisting of orthodontists, treat the teeth, periodontals, jaw and nerves.


Orthodontists and dental professionals both provide oral treatment for people. Orthodontists can work in a dental office and provide the exact same therapies as various other dental professionals. You can think of both doctors who deal with gum and teeth issues. The primary difference is that becoming an orthodontist needs a specific specialized in dealing with the misalignment of the teeth and jaw.

This consists of all the necessary education to become a general dental expert. According to the American Pupil Dental Association (ASDA), it means you will certainly need to have either a Doctor of Medicine in Dentistry (DMD) or a Physician of Dental Surgery (DDS). Simply put, orthodontists need to complete oral college and afterwards get an orthodontics specialty education and learning.
